Non-black antistatics allow surface resistivities roughly in the range of 10 to 10 ohms per square to be obtained but their action generally depends on the relative humidity. However, new generations are being marketed without this drawback and are efficient at a relative humidity as low as 15%. Some are offered in masterbatches based on polyolefins, polystyrenes, polyesters, acrylics, ABS, polyacetals. .. [Pg.211]

There are specific grades and masterbatches of carbon blacks especially marketed as additives for conductive plastics. It should be noted that the carbon blacks modify other properties of the polymer, especially its colour. [Pg.211]

Specific grades of carbon and steel fibres are especially marketed as additives for conductive plastics allowing resistivities of roughly 10 ohm.cm to be obtained. The other properties of the final material - colour, modulus, impact strength. .. are modified. Carbon fibres have a large reinforcing effect. [Pg.211]
